During health teaching, the nurse encourages a patient to exercise regularly and eat a balanced
diet. The nurse is performing her role as a/an:
A. Caregiver
B. Educator
C. Communicator
D. Advocate
Ans - B. Educator
The nurse as an educator helps the client gain knowledge and skills related to health and self-
care. As a caregiver, the nurse provides direct care. As a communicator, the nurse shares
information with others. As an advocate, the nurse protects the client’s rights.

A nurse notices a patient showing signs of anxiety and listens attentively while maintaining eye
contact. The nurse is performing the role of a:
A. Communicator
B. Advocate
C. Educator
D. Researcher
Ans - A. Communicator
The nurse as a communicator builds trust and understanding through active listening. As an
advocate, the nurse supports the patient’s rights. As an educator, the nurse provides health
teaching. As a researcher, the nurse contributes to evidence-based practice.

A nurse provides comfort to a terminally ill patient by holding their hand and staying by their
side. This demonstrates the role of a:
A. Caregiver
B. Advocate
C. Educator
D. Manager
Ans - A. Caregiver
The nurse as a caregiver provides emotional and physical support to promote comfort and
dignity. An advocate protects rights, an educator gives information, and a manager coordinates
care.
